[Data integration, data mining and visualization analysis of traditional Chinese medicine manufacturing process]
Summary
Industrial big data from traditional Chinese medicine (TCM) manufacturing offers opportunities for process improvement. Data mining and visualization technologies are key to unlocking this potential for better performance.
Area of Science:
- Pharmaceutical Manufacturing
- Traditional Chinese Medicine (TCM)
- Industrial Big Data
Context:
- The TCM industry is increasingly adopting industrial automatic control technology, generating vast amounts of manufacturing data.
- This data presents significant opportunities for enhancing process understanding and performance.
- Effective data integration and management systems are crucial for leveraging this industrial big data.
Purpose:
- To introduce key technologies supporting TCM manufacturing and industrial big data management.
- To highlight the importance of data mining and visualization technologies in this context.
- To demonstrate the practical application of these technologies using real-world manufacturing data.
Summary:
- This paper explores the application of industrial big data in TCM manufacturing, focusing on data mining and visualization.
- It discusses the necessity of data integration and management systems to overcome data silos.
- A case study using historical data from Shengmai injection production illustrates the effectiveness of these technologies.
Impact:
- Implementing data mining and visualization can break down data silos, leading to the discovery of valuable insights.
- Improved data management enhances the efficiency of collecting, storing, analyzing, and visualizing manufacturing data.
- These advancements ultimately contribute to significant improvements in TCM manufacturing process performance.
